AWS Lambda Durable functions让我们能够构建长时间运行的有状态工作流,无需管理任何服务器即可执行长达一年。
核心实现原理是Checkpoint / Replay 机制
与Azure Durable Functions类似,AWS也使用检查点和重放机制:
执行 → 在关键点创建checkpoint → 中断/等待
↓
恢复 → 从头重放代码
↓
跳过已完成的checkpoint → 继续执行
构建多步骤应用程序和 AI 工作流不应该意味着编写自定义复杂代码。开发人员往往花费太多时间跟踪进度、编写错误处理逻辑和管理重试,而不是专注于创新。
AWS Lambda Durable functions简化了这一切。使用我们的编程语言和 IDE 编写代码,同时Durable functions提供内置模式来管理进度和错误处理。
使用 Lambda Durable functions更快地构建多步骤应用程序和 AI 工作流,无需编写复杂逻辑或管理基础设施。